Video presents challenging femtosecond laser-assisted cataract surgery cases with premature gas breakthrough during corneal wound construction, problems in accessing corneal incisions, limbal relaxing incision placement, and difficulties with incomplete caspulorhexis and lens fragmentation. It also illustrates approaches to handling challenges such as post-radial-keratectomy eyes, brunescent cataracts, and white cataracts.
